R50 5 spd a/c on, idle bottoms out when compressor kicks on

so, when I am at a light in neutral and the a/c is on, and the compressor kicks on, it really drops the engine idle speed almost but not quite to the point of feeling like the car is going to stall before the idle comes back up.

any ideas if any thing can be done, solutions? known issue? thanks

This is a normal operating event.
When the A/C compressor kicks in, it produces more load on the engine.
Since the engine is in the idle mode, the driver will feel difference it the engine RPM.
When driving at 70 mph, the compressor kicks in but the effect is not felt because of the higher RPM and speed.

You may improve things by trying to clean the trottlebody, that helped in the old days, but honestly, it sounds like any 1.6 litre engine I have been in. I hate running AC myself, but once the revs get up, it isn't bad. Merging into traffic takes a different technique by a long way.
